VS Code Timeline — Su sistema de control de versiones local — Amit Merchant — Un blog sobre PHP, JavaScript y más

Si es un desarrollador, debe estar familiarizado con el concepto de control de versiones. Es un sistema que registra los cambios realizados en un archivo o conjunto de archivos a lo largo del tiempo para que pueda recuperar versiones específicas más adelante.

El sistema de control de versiones más popular es Git. Es un sistema de control de versiones distribuido que le permite realizar un seguimiento del historial de su código fuente. También es una poderosa herramienta que le permite colaborar con los miembros de su equipo.

¿Qué pasaría si pudiera tener un sistema de control de versiones para sus archivos locales? Un sistema que le permite realizar un seguimiento de los cambios cada vez que guarda un archivo. Y un sistema que te permite volver a una versión anterior de un archivo si así lo deseas. ¿Todo esto sin tener que configurar un repositorio Git?

Aquí es donde está el código VS "Cronología" Funcionalidad a la que nunca había prestado atención hasta ahora entra en juego.

Índice
  1. La pestaña Línea de tiempo
  2. En conclusión

La pestaña Línea de tiempo

Esencialmente, el "Cronología" la función es VS Code control de versiones locales sistema que le permite realizar un seguimiento de los cambios que realiza en sus archivos. Es una excelente manera de realizar un seguimiento de los cambios que realiza en sus archivos y volver a una versión anterior si lo desea.

Puedes encontrarlo debajo Timeline pestaña en el panel Explorador. Esto es lo que parece.

Como puede ver, cuando expande el "Cronología" , puede ver la lista de instantáneas (tomadas al guardar el archivo) que ha realizado para ese archivo en particular. También puede ver los cambios que realizó (diff) en un archivo haciendo clic en la instantánea tal como lo hace en la pestaña Control de código fuente.

Cuando pasa el cursor sobre una instantánea, puede ver la fecha y la hora en que se tomó la instantánea, lo cual es muy útil.

Además de esto, el "Cronología" La pestaña también muestra las confirmaciones de Git. Entonces, si está usando Git, puede ver las confirmaciones de Git, así como las instantáneas que ha creado para el archivo. Las confirmaciones de Git están representadas por un ícono diferente en la línea de tiempo, como puede ver en la captura de pantalla anterior. El primer elemento en la línea de tiempo es la confirmación de Git y el segundo elemento es la instantánea.

En conclusión

En general, el "Cronología" es una excelente manera de realizar un seguimiento de los archivos que no desea enviar a Git, como los archivos de entorno. ¡Y ciertamente puede ahorrarle muchos problemas si alguna vez necesita volver a una versión anterior de un archivo en caso de que se haya perdido algo!

Si quieres conocer otros artículos parecidos a VS Code Timeline — Su sistema de control de versiones local — Amit Merchant — Un blog sobre PHP, JavaScript y más puedes visitar la categoría Código.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ir

Esta página web utiliza cookies para analizar de forma anónima y estadística el uso que haces de la web, mejorar los contenidos y tu experiencia de navegación. Para más información accede a la Política de Cookies . Ver mas